C41H49FN5O8P Cytidinum, N-acetyl-5′-O-[bis(4-methoxyphenyl)phenylmethyl]-2′-deoxy-2′-fluoro-, 3′-[2-cyanoethyl N,N-bis(1-methylethyl)phosphoramiditum] (ACI)
Numerus Registri CAS
159414-99-0
| Proprietates Physicae Claves | Valor | Conditio | 
| Pondus Moleculare | 789.83 | - | 
| pKa (Praedictum) | 10.11±0.20 | Temperatura Acida Maxima: 25°C | 
Subrisus Canonici
N#CCCOP(OC1C(F)C(OC1COC(C=2C=CC=CC2)(C3=CC=C(OC)C=C3)C4=CC=C(OC)C=C4)N5C=CC(= NC5=O)NC(=O)C)N(C(C)C)C(C)C
Subrisus Isomerici
C(OC[C@@H]¹[C@@H](OP(N(C(C)C)C(C)C)OCCC#N)[C@@H](F)[C@@H](O¹)N²C(=O)N=C(NC(C)=O)C=C2)(C3=CC=C(OC)C=C3)(C4=CC=C (OC)C=C4)C5=CC=CC=C5
InChI
InChI= 1S/C41H49FN5O8P/c1-27(2)47(28(3)4)56(53-25-11-23-43)55-38-35(54-39(37(38)42)46-24-22-36(44-29(5)48)45-40(46)49)26-52- 41 (30-12-9-8-10-13-30, 31-14-18-33 (50-6) 19-15-31) 32-16-20-34 (51-7) 21-17-32/h8-10, 12-22, 24, 27-28, 35, 37-39H, 11, 25-26H2, 1-7H3, (H, 44, 45, 48, 49)/t35-, 37-, 38-, 39-, 56?/m¹/s¹.
Clavis InChI
CNFKJHKDSRXNFL-UTXREMQHSA-N
1 Aliud Nomen pro hac Substantia
CytidinumN-acetylum-5′-O- [bis(4-methoxyphenyl)phenylmethyl]-2′-deoxy-2′-fluoro-, 3′-[2-cyanoethyl bis(1-methylethyl)phosphoramiditum] (9CI)
